
The reason for Lokomotiv Moscow football club striker Vadim Rakov being loaned to the Wings team in Samara has been revealed. This was reported by Euro-football.ru.
According to the club management, the player has developed a gambling addiction and has spent most of his money on betting games. Although his salary at Lokomotiv was one million rubles, this amount was not sufficient for him.
As a result, he borrowed money from various places, took out loans, and also asked his teammates for money. Once this situation became known to the management, Lokomotiv decided to loan the player to the Wings team for educational purposes.
This was reported by the Shot news channel. For reference, after the first three rounds of the 2025/2026 season, Vadim Rakov has scored four goals and is among the top scorers in the Russian Premier League.
Club representatives emphasize that they are closely monitoring the player's future activities and his situation. Thus, the Lokomotiv management considers this decision to be correct in order to help the player and get him out of the problematic situation.
